The two-year Post-Graduate Programme in Food and Agri-Business Management (PGP-FABM), offered by the Indian Institute of Management-Ahmedabad, has been ranked Number One in the world for three consecutive years by Eduniversal, Paris, France, including for the year 2017-18.

A Post-Graduate Programme with Specialization Package in Agriculture (PGP-SPA) was started in 1974. In 2000, IIMA revamped it following the Institute’s new approach to agri-business management education under changing economic environment.

More than 125,000 candidates apply for this programme each year and only about 46 are selected from across India.

The PGP-FABM is a full- time residential programme that evolved and expanded beyond agriculture to other allied areas such as food processing, commodities and rural development sector, and rural infrastructure, according to a press release here on Tuesday.
